Will it be that 10% of people are suicidal and it always predicts non-suicidal? Will it be that accuracy actually means AUC? Will it be that they are reporting predictive skill on the training data?

It's training data. There's 17 suicidal and 17 non-suicidal scans, for a total of 34 scans. They trained 34 models, leaving one scan out each time. Of those 34 models, 31 correctly predicted the left-out scan.

IANAStatistician, but this seems like a trash result.

"This study used machine-learning algorithms (Gaussian Naive Bayes) to identify such individuals (17 suicidal ideators versus 17 controls) with high (91%) accuracy, based on their altered functional magnetic resonance imaging neural signatures of death-related and life-related concepts." Anyone with a Nature subscription want to check whether they simply trained their discriminator and then used it on the same data s…

17 subjects per group is extremely small. Looking at it either from a machine learning or statistical point of view, using such a small sample is problematic. This is the chronic issue with fMRI studies, since administering an fMRI is extremely expensive, and has led to some very difficult to reproduce results in the field.

I believe some pretty fundamental fMRI spatial autocorrelation functions have been called into question as well (1). Sounds a bit like PowerPoint's autocontent wizard.
